The US sends cluster bombs to Ukraine for a counteroffensive

Date:

NATO has left the decision to supply cluster munitions to Ukraine to the allies. Spain has positioned itself against shipping.

Despite criticism from Germany and organizations such as Human Rights Watch (HWR), the United States has confirmed that it will send cluster bombs to Ukraine because of the great danger to the civilian population.

According to Joe Biden, the decision was “difficult” but necessary because “the Ukrainians are out of ammunition”.

The announcement is not without surprise and controversy. This explosive has been banned in more than 100 countries in violation of United Nations warnings. However, it has already been used in the war in Ukraine by both Russian and Ukrainian forces, resulting in civilian casualties and serious injuries to survivors.

A significant number of the sub-projectiles dropped by these types of bombs do not explode, so they can remain in the ground and activate long after a conflict has ended.

In their announcement, US authorities insist that only devices with a failure rate of less than 2.35% be sent to Ukraine. In contrast, according to U.S. officials, the cluster bombs used by Russia since the invasion began have a failure rate of between 30 and 40%.

NATO Secretary General Jens Stoltenberg has left the decision to supply cluster munitions to Ukraine in the hands of allies after recalling that there is no common position within NATO on the 2008 Cluster Munitions Convention that use, development, production, acquisition, storage and transfer of this class of weapons.

“Some allies have signed the convention and others have not. It is an individual decision to decide on the delivery of this military aid to Ukraine. It is up to the governments and not the alliance,” said NATO’s political chief.

Defense Secretary Margarita Robles has assured that she “does not share” and is “against” the US decision.

Russian Ambassador to the United States Anatoli Antonov sees the decision to send cluster bombs to Ukraine as another American provocation that “brings humanity closer to another world war”.

From Russia, they have also denounced that the United States has “ignored the negative opinions of its allies about the dangers of the indiscriminate use of cluster munitions”, just as it “turns a blind eye to civilian casualties”.
